Soil, Investigation and Testing - Water Content - Part 2: Determination by Rapid Methods

DIN 18121-2 is a standard that provides guidelines for determining the water content of soil using rapid methods. The scope of this document is to establish the procedures for cohesive and non-cohesive soils where the soil constituents remain unchanged chemically during the testing process.

The standard recognizes the need for quick and efficient methods to determine the water content of soil samples. These rapid methods are useful in cases where a high volume of samples needs to be tested or where time constraints exist.

By following the procedures outlined in DIN 18121-2, one can accurately measure the water content of both cohesive and non-cohesive soils. It is important to note that the methods described in this standard are applicable only to soils where the solid components do not undergo any chemical transformations during the testing process.
